Lust & Laune Blauer Portugieser 

Ruby red, youthfully fresh bouquet.  A fruity, easy drinking red wine loaded with plum and dark berry fruits this wine boasts notes of spice, tobacco, and black pepper! Just delicious!

Blauer Portugieser is a red Austrian and German wine grap  e found primarily in the Rheinhessen, Pfalz and wine regions of Lower Austria. Wine cellars usually vinify a simple light red wine, which is characterized by a fresh, tart and light body. Since 2000, higher quality wines have been vinified from Portugieser grapes. The use of oak provides additional aromas in order to compete with Bordeaux varieties.

Winery Günter & Regina Trie White

Blend of Chardonnay, Yellow Muscat, Muscat Ottonel

Yellow with greenish reflections, clearly visible viscosity. A fresh bunch of yellow flowers in the nose, followed by pomelo filets and ripe, red bell peppers. Additionally accompanied by juicy pear pulp and a twinkle of lemon, all immediately merging to a multi -layered aroma spectrum. Dry with creamy acidity and spice. Perfectly balanced between hearty power and animating elegance.
